The Nebraska Beef Manufacturers Director of Training, Sophia Lentfer has introduced that programs are actually being approved for the Larry E. Sitzman Adolescence in Nebraska Agriculture Scholarship. School scholars enrolled as full-time undergraduate or graduate scholars at an absolutely authorised Nebraska faculty, college or technical faculty in an agriculture similar level program are inspired to use.

The scholarship established in 2017 honors Larry E. Sitzman, who retired in 2016 as Government Director of the Nebraska Beef Manufacturers Affiliation. The Larry E. Sitzman Adolescence in Nebraska Agriculture Scholarship is a $1,000 scholarship that will likely be awarded to at least one deserving applicant.

Eligibility Necessities:

  • Should be lately enrolled as a full-time undergraduate or graduate pupil at an absolutely authorised Nebraska faculty, college, or technical faculty in an agriculture similar level program
  • Should have no less than one complete yr of analysis final towards a point
  • Should have plans to paintings within the agriculture business upon commencement
